Transaction d30a415062090f97b50ca8fa5aa4d35fea2c937d345ddc84bba26732e8da833a
1 Input
1 Output
-
d30a415062090f97b50ca8fa5aa4d35fea2c937d345ddc84bba26732e8da833a:0
- value
- 52787
- script pubkey
- OP_0 OP_PUSHBYTES_20 d7673028b47fd36ee7c9fe7cd42a2152abc7445e
- address
- bc1q6annq2950lfkae7fle7dg23p224uw3z7077re2